webservice 參數類型


1、基本數據類型

包括: String、Int32、Byte、Boolean、Int16、Int64、Single、Double、Decimal、
DateTime(類似XML中的timeInstant)、 DateTime(類似XML中的date)、DateTime(類似XML中的time)以及XmlQualifiedName(類似XML中的QName)。
枚舉類型  比如: "public enum color { red=1, blue=2 }"

2、基礎類型數組,枚舉類型數組 上述類型的數組,比如 string[] 和 int[]

 

3、創建存儲復雜對象的類(因為WebServices的復雜對象的傳遞,一定要借助第三方對象(即自定義對象)來實現)

傳遞List、Map、數組、自定義對象

  前提:JavaBean的使用--- 必須是可序列化的。
 
需要向webservice傳遞的對象,其中屬性也要支持序列化
 
4、傳遞圖片:
方案一:轉換成byte[]數組
方案二:生成Base64編碼格式的字符串
 
建議的寫法:
提供一個字符串型的參數,定義JSON格式的數據傳遞。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M